Individuals who are physically dependent to drugs or alcohol and want assistance will initially go through detox before receiving other treatment services in drug rehab. Detoxification is basically the process of the drug being removed from one's system, which is typically uncomfortable and may hold risks if not conducted in a setting which can provide appropriate support and medical intervention as necessary. Detoxification services are supplied at either a professional drug or alcohol detoxification facility or a drug rehabilitation facility which can properly oversee and provide medical supervision for persons who are just coming off of drugs. Detoxification services typically include insuring the individual is as comfortable as possible while detoxing and going through drug or alcohol withdrawal, offering proper nutrition and making certain the particular person is getting proper rest, and providing supplements and medicine as needed to make the detox process as easy and safe as possible. The individual in detox will sometimes be encouraged to take part in some kind of physical activity such as walking, yoga, etc. At a drug detox facility or drug rehabilitation facility which can provide detox services, the person will have detoxification staff at their disposal around the clock to make certain that any issues are handled as swiftly and safely as possible.
